The 2025 Problem: Migrations Break Everything
Traditional approaches to OpenTelemetry migration require massive re-instrumentation efforts. You're forced to choose between:
- Ripping out existing agents and dashboards, creating blind spots during the transition
- Running dual systems indefinitely, multiplying complexity and costs
- Delaying migration indefinitely, falling further behind on standardization

Your 2026 Migration Checklist
Ready to start? Here are the essential first steps:
- Inventory your current proprietary agents and monitoring dependencies
- Map which dashboards rely on specific data formats
- Deploy Mezmo's Edge collectors as an intelligent processing layer
- Configure dual-stream routing to maintain continuity
- Start with non-critical services to build confidence
The goal isn't perfection on day one. It's continuous progress aligned with your business priorities.
